Bridging Empathy and Strategic Value: New Research Highlights Human-Centered Innovation in AI
Youngsoo Shin, PhD, assistant professor in Pace University's Seidenberg School of Computer Science and Information Systems, has recently published two papers in leading international journals that explore a common question from different perspectives: how can artificial intelligence be designed to better serve people?
Published in two of the leading journals in their respective fields—the International Journal of Human-Computer Studies, widely recognized as one of the top journals in human-computer interaction, and the International Journal of Project Management, a premier publication in project management research—the studies examine human-centered artificial intelligence at both the individual and organizational level. Understanding Human-AI Interaction
In his paper, Empathy in Action: An Empirical Exploration of User Perspectives on Conversational Agent Empathy, Shin investigates how users perceive empathy in conversational AI systems such as chatbots and virtual assistants. As AI becomes increasingly integrated into everyday interactions, understanding what makes these systems feel supportive, trustworthy, and responsive has become an important challenge.
The study identified four key characteristics that shape perceptions of empathy in conversational agents: active listening, personalization, emotional expressivity, and persona attractiveness. The findings revealed that while active listening and personalization consistently strengthened positive user experiences, more emotionally expressive AI systems could also introduce unintended effects, highlighting the complexity of designing AI that fosters meaningful engagement and trust.
The research offers practical guidance for designers and developers seeking to create AI systems that resonate with users while maintaining a careful balance between emotional connection and functionality.
The Future of AI Project Management
Shin's second publication, From Data to Experience: Framework for Managing Artificial Intelligence System Development Projects, expands the conversation beyond individual interactions to the organizational processes that shape AI development.
The study introduces a framework that integrates human-centered design principles with data-driven project management, helping organizations navigate the increasingly complex task of developing AI systems. Rather than focusing solely on technical implementation, the framework emphasizes collaboration, strategic thinking, and long-term value creation.
By bringing together perspectives from design, data science, and project management, the research offers a new approach to managing AI initiatives, one that recognizes the importance of both technological capability and human experience.
